摘要
Introduction: Metallosis from total hip arthroplasty is usually due to trunnionosis and is associated with elevated serum cobalt and chromium levels. Titanium levels usually remain normal. Methods: Here, we report two rare cases of elevated titanium levels, both with the same mechanism, which is a previously unreported cause of titanium metallosis. Results: In these cases, contact between cables and the titanium stem were the source. Discussion: Reports of isolated high titanium levels associated with total hip arthroplasty are rare. These cases illustrate a new mechanism from which this situation may arise.
